Bug description:
When I try and submit a LO crash report, I get the following error
Cannot connect to crash database, please check your Internet
connection. <urlopen error [Errno 32] Broken pipe>
My internet is fine as I can submit other crash reports and also this
report is via apport.
Please see the attached report that causes the error
